Morrisville is a charming village located in Madison County, New York. It is a small, close-knit community with a population of around 2,000 residents. The village is situated in the heart of Central New York and is known for its picturesque countryside, friendly locals, and rich history.
One of the most notable features of Morrisville is its beautiful natural surroundings. The village is surrounded by rolling hills, lush farmland, and meandering streams, making it a perfect destination for outdoor enthusiasts. There are numerous opportunities for hiking, fishing, and birdwatching in the area, and the nearby Chenango Canal Path offers a scenic route for walking and biking.
Morrisville is also home to the State University of New York College of Agriculture and Technology at Morrisville, commonly referred to as Morrisville State College. The college is nestled in the heart of the village and contributes to the vibrant and youthful atmosphere of Morrisville. The campus features stunning architecture and offers a wide range of academic programs, as well as a variety of cultural and recreational activities for students and community members.
The village has a rich history that is evident in its well-preserved architecture and landmarks. Visitors can explore historic buildings such as the Morrisville Community Church, the Madison Hall, and the Hamilton Inn, which give a glimpse into the village’s past. The Madison County Historical Society also offers resources and exhibits that showcase the area’s heritage and culture.
In addition to its natural beauty and historical significance, Morrisville offers a range of dining, shopping, and entertainment options. The village is home to a variety of locally-owned businesses, including cafes, restaurants, and boutique shops, where visitors can sample delicious food and shop for unique products.
Overall, Morrisville is a hidden gem in Central New York, offering a peaceful and welcoming environment for residents and visitors alike. Its natural beauty, rich history, and small-town charm make it a wonderful place to visit or call home.
